To the release manager: I'm passing ownership of the Pellwick deep-link router to Sorrel before the 4.2 cut. The intent-matching table now lives in the Farrowgate config service; stale entries were purged last sprint. Watch the fallback route — it silently swallows malformed slugs, which inflated our drop-off metrics in March. The staging resolver needs its keystore unlocked before each regression pass, and that keystore accepts only one credential. For the signing vault, the recovery phrase is noted directly below.

recovery phrase for tafog-fafog: novix-novdor-fraath-brieth-olieth-oliix-rusix-wenion-julax-druox

Quarterly Planning Note — Dunmere Fabrication

Branch managers: the Dunmere line will run a second shift from next quarter rather than adding floor space. Capex deferral saves roughly 14% against plan. Expect longer lead times on custom orders through the transition month. Staffing requests go to regional ops by the 15th. Forecasts update Friday. The confidential note below outlines the capacity plans behind this decision.

board note of tawig-bajof: The renewal with Ralixix Holdings closes at $10 million a year, 20 percent above the last contract. Project Druix slips by two quarters because of the tooling delay.

Break-glass access — GlimmerProf (GPU memory profiler). For contractors only. Use when the profiling daemon on the Tarnwood cluster hangs and normal auth is down. Do not use for routine captures. Steps: stop the collector, flag the incident in the Oxbow channel, then open the emergency console on the head node. Access is audited; misuse revokes contractor credentials. All break-glass sessions expire after one hour. To unlock the emergency console, enter the recovery passphrase shown below.

unlock words, yagag-yahog: gordor-zorvan-druius-queniel-normir-norwyn-framir-novmir-ralius-holwyn-wenwyn-tamael-silok-holdor